What You’ll Need

  • Bachelor's Degree preferred
  • 5 years sales experience
  • 2 years of relevant sales experience
  • 2 years of sales leadership preferred
  • Maintenance experience with Industrial and Utility customers
  • Demonstrated sales experience and operational exposure in electrical distribution or similar B2B industry
  • Experience developing and implementing sales strategies
  • Valid Driver’s License

Knowledge, Skills & Abilities

  • Demonstrated track record of sales management achievement
  • Excellent verbal and written communication, and presentation skills
  • Excellent at managing time, priorities, and expenses
  • Ability to establish good relationships and credibility with customers; ability to collaborate at all levels
  • Action oriented
  • Customer focus
  • Results driven
  • Organizational agility
  • Ability to build effective teams and develop direct reports and others
  • Conflict management
  • Business acumen
  • Knowledge of Microsoft Office

Working Conditions and Physical Demands

The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. The work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

Working Environment:

  • Exposed to unpleasant or disagreeable physical environment such as high noise level and/or exposure to heat and cold Occasionally – up to 20%
  • Exposed to electrical hazards; risk of electrical shock Occasionally – up to 20%
  • Handles or works with potentially dangerous equipment Occasionally – up to 20%
  • Travels to offsite locations Constantly – at least 51%

Physical Demands:

  • Sit: Must be able to remain in a stationary position Occasionally – up to 20%
  • Walk: Must be able to move about inside/outside office or work location Constantly – at least 51%
  • Use hands to finger, handle or feel: Operates a computer and other office machinery Frequently – 21% to 50%
  • Stoop, kneel, crouch, or crawl: Must be able to crouch down to stock shelfs, pick up boxes, or position one’s self to maintain computers in the lab/under desks/in server closet Occasionally – up to 20%
  • Climb or balance: Must be able to ascend/descend on a ladder, forklift, pallet jack, or other warehouse equipment None
  • Talk, hear, taste, smell: Must be able to use senses to; effectively communicate with co-workers and clients and detect hazardous conditions Frequently – 21% to 50%

Weight and Force:

  • Up to 10 pounds Frequently – 21% to 50%
  • Up to 25 pounds Occasionally – up to 20%
  • Up to 50 pounds None
  • Up to 75 pounds None

About rexel usa

Rexel USA is a Texas-based distributor of electrical parts and related components for sectors such as commercial, residential, and industrial.
